George Henry (1858-1943) Portrait Of A Little Girl
George Henry Scottish painter, deeply marked the school of Glasgow became a member of the Royal Scottish Academy in 1902. Our charming study is treated with a lively and spontaneous touch as well as a mastery worthy of a quality artist. Indeed an exhibition was dedicated to him in 2007 at the National Gallery of Victoria in Melbourne. The paintings of this artist are present in public collections such as the museum of Edinburgh, Glasgow and also Montreal.
